/*!
\since 5.5
Calculates \a roll, \a pitch, and \a yaw Euler angles (in degrees)
that corresponds to this quaternion.
\sa fromEulerAngles()
*/
void QQuaternion::toEulerAngles(float *pitch, float *yaw, float *roll) const
{
Q_ASSERT(pitch && yaw && roll);
// Algorithm from:
// http://www.j3d.org/matrix_faq/matrfaq_latest.html#Q37
float xx = xp * xp;
float xy = xp * yp;
float xz = xp * zp;
float xw = xp * wp;
float yy = yp * yp;
float yz = yp * zp;
float yw = yp * wp;
float zz = zp * zp;
float zw = zp * wp;
const float lengthSquared = xx + yy + zz + wp * wp;
if (!qFuzzyIsNull(lengthSquared - 1.0f) && !qFuzzyIsNull(lengthSquared)) {
xx /= lengthSquared;
xy /= lengthSquared; // same as (xp / length) * (yp / length)
xz /= lengthSquared;
xw /= lengthSquared;
yy /= lengthSquared;
yz /= lengthSquared;
yw /= lengthSquared;
zz /= lengthSquared;
zw /= lengthSquared;
}
*pitch = asinf(-2.0f * (yz - xw));
if (*pitch < M_PI_2) {
if (*pitch > -M_PI_2) {
*yaw = atan2f(2.0f * (xz + yw), 1.0f - 2.0f * (xx + yy));
*roll = atan2f(2.0f * (xy + zw), 1.0f - 2.0f * (xx + zz));
} else {
// not a unique solution
*roll = 0.0f;
*yaw = -atan2f(-2.0f * (xy - zw), 1.0f - 2.0f * (yy + zz));
}
} else {
// not a unique solution
*roll = 0.0f;
*yaw = atan2f(-2.0f * (xy - zw), 1.0f - 2.0f * (yy + zz));
}
*pitch = qRadiansToDegrees(*pitch);
*yaw = qRadiansToDegrees(*yaw);
*roll = qRadiansToDegrees(*roll);
}
/*!
\since 5.5
Creates a quaternion that corresponds to a rotation of
\a roll degrees around the z axis, \a pitch degrees around the x axis,
and \a yaw degrees around the y axis (in that order).
\sa toEulerAngles()
*/
QQuaternion QQuaternion::fromEulerAngles(float pitch, float yaw, float roll)
{
// Algorithm from:
// http://www.j3d.org/matrix_faq/matrfaq_latest.html#Q60
pitch = qDegreesToRadians(pitch);
yaw = qDegreesToRadians(yaw);
roll = qDegreesToRadians(roll);
pitch *= 0.5f;
yaw *= 0.5f;
roll *= 0.5f;
const float c1 = cosf(yaw);
const float s1 = sinf(yaw);
const float c2 = cosf(roll);
const float s2 = sinf(roll);
const float c3 = cosf(pitch);
const float s3 = sinf(pitch);
const float c1c2 = c1 * c2;
const float s1s2 = s1 * s2;
const float w = c1c2 * c3 + s1s2 * s3;
const float x = c1c2 * s3 + s1s2 * c3;
const float y = s1 * c2 * c3 - c1 * s2 * s3;
const float z = c1 * s2 * c3 - s1 * c2 * s3;
return QQuaternion(w, x, y, z);
}

// This is a more tolerant version of qFuzzyCompare that also handles the case
// where one or more of the values being compare are close to zero
static inline bool myFuzzyCompare(float p1, float p2)
{
if (qFuzzyIsNull(p1))
return qFuzzyIsNull(p2);
if (qFuzzyIsNull(p2))
return false;
// a very slightly looser version of qFuzzyCompare
// for use with values that are not very close to zero
return qAbs(p1 - p2) <= 0.00003f * qMin(qAbs(p1), qAbs(p2));
}
static inline bool myFuzzyCompareRadians(float p1, float p2)
{
static const float fPI = float(M_PI);
if (p1 < -fPI)
p1 += 2.0f * fPI;
else if (p1 > fPI)
p1 -= 2.0f * fPI;
if (p2 < -fPI)
p2 += 2.0f * fPI;
else if (p2 > fPI)
p2 -= 2.0f * fPI;
return qAbs(qAbs(p1) - qAbs(p2)) <= qDegreesToRadians(0.05f);
}
static inline bool myFuzzyCompareDegrees(float p1, float p2)
{
p1 = qDegreesToRadians(p1);
p2 = qDegreesToRadians(p2);
return myFuzzyCompareRadians(p1, p2);
}
